Transaction 50ddf9f6ca6e6c80ff220a790c69728213678eac192614fd205b7c79149d3b30
1 Input
1 Output
-
50ddf9f6ca6e6c80ff220a790c69728213678eac192614fd205b7c79149d3b30:0
- value
- 559528
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 04c4a4080fdad45881dbcfc92a5e309d18e81d6d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1SDGc9efXQLkZPUtrMKGJN4TJ25o3gtdH